Great Staycations: Trump International Beach Resort

Trump International Beach Resort 

18001 Collins Ave., Sunny Isles Beach

About the resort: Sophistication meets comfort at this Forbes four-star property that overlooks the Atlantic Ocean. Each of the 360 spacious guest rooms and suites feature a furnished balcony; all one- and two-bedroom suites include a full kitchen (junior suites and higher have an in-room washer and dryer). In addition to its two luxury pools, families also have access to the supervised, interactive Planet Kids program (ages 4 to 12); a sports court that offers space for soccer and basketball; and a slew of water sports (jet skis, surfboards, kayaks and more). Dining options abound, from the casual beachside fare at Gili’s Beach Club & Pool Bar to the relaxed upscale vibe of Neomi’s Grill (with indoor seating and outdoor tables overlooking the pool) to casual dishes and signature cocktails at the Lobby Bar & Grill. For shopping enthusiasts, the resort is only minutes from the Aventura Mall and the Village at Gulfstream Park.

Isn’t that special: Interior designer Carolina Keimig, the creative mind behind the resort’s original lobby design, has returned two decades later to infuse that same lobby with an opulence rooted in nature. Expect an earthy color scheme (bronzes, seafoam greens, blues) along with rich woods, metallics and mother-of-pearl details. Among the highlights: a honeycomb-shaped chandelier above the main seating area; an onyx back wall behind the front desk; decorative indoor plant life, including biophilic elements from a preserved moss wall; round sectionals and circular tables for intimate seating areas … Summer specials include rates from $159.
